Subject: Cut-over done — replica lag alarm notes

Hey all — the Pondwick cut-over finished last night, smoother than expected. One gotcha: the read-replica lag alarm got wiped when we tore down the old monitor stack, so I rebuilt it by hand. Future maintainers, please don't tweak thresholds without telling the data team. Here's the config I used.

deployment values, tafof-taduf:
pelius:
  pin: 6508
  tenant: praiel
  seal: seal_4e33a2f4
  metrics_host: metrics.pelius.plorvagrid.corp
  standby_team: druix
  escalation: juldor-norius
  nonce: 5db598

### How are user-supplied formulas sandboxed?

Formulas submitted through CalcWeave are never evaluated in-process. Each expression is parsed into a restricted AST, rejecting any node type outside the arithmetic and lookup whitelist, then executed in an isolated interpreter with a 50ms CPU budget and no filesystem or network access. Maintainers extending the whitelist must add corresponding fuzz cases first. If you're unsure whether a new node type is safe, ask the sandbox owners at the address below.

escalation mailbox, bafog-fafog: ulador@paliqlabs.internal

Ticket #—missed pick-up, Dock 4. Courier from Harrowline Freight never showed for the Veltrix prototype units bound for the Ashgrove test lab. Units are still crated and sealed in the staging cage. Rebooked for tomorrow, first window. Shift lead: keep the cage locked, no partial releases, and confirm crate count against the manifest before release. Follow the confidential hand-over instruction below exactly when the driver arrives.

drop instructions, yafog-yawip: the quenmir olidor courier leaves the julox tamion keliel ledger at gate 5283 under passcode 336825

Finance Review Summary — Project Larkspur Delay

For the finance team. Project Larkspur, the internal billing migration at Fennick & Rowe, has slipped two quarters due to vendor integration issues. Sunk costs remain within contingency; run-rate savings are now deferred to next fiscal year. Accrual treatment unchanged. Budget re-baselining is scheduled for the steering review. Broader planning implications are noted below.

confidential, kagep-kahof: Druokax Systems plans to lower the Ulaath list price by 53 percent in March.